The Fusion Advanced Development Kit is fully RoHS-compliant and provides an excellent platform for developing microprocessor applications and other system management applications. The M1AFS1500 ARM®-enabled Fusion mixed-signal flash FPGA on the board supports ARM Cortex™-M1, Core8051s, and other soft IP processors. The kit supports the following functions:
- Power-up detection
- Thermal management
- Power sequencing
- Sleep modes
- System diagnostics
- Remote communications
- Clock generation and management
The Fusion Advanced Development Kit also includes support for the Mixed-signal Power Manager (MPM) Demonstration. The lower section of the board marked Power Supply MGMT Area can be used in conjunction with the MPM design example to develop voltage sequencing and power management.

Note: M1FAS-ADV-DEV-KIT does not include power supplies, so for this kit you must also order two of the 9V POWER PACKs. M1AFS-ADV-DEV-KIT-PWR includes the two power packs.

Development Board with an M1AFS1500-FGG484 mixed-signal FPGA
- Memory Options
- SRAM — 4 MB (2x1 Mx16)
- Flash — 64-Mbit parallel flash memory (2x16 Mx6)
- SPI Flash — 2-MB SPI-based flash device
- Clock Sources on board
- OSC-50 50 MHz clock oscillator
- OSC-32 32.768 KHz off-chip crystal oscillator
- Interfaces
- Ethernet — 10/100 interface
- USB/UART — Provide USB/UART adapter chip and connector
- I2C header — 3 ports for I2C interface
- Interface connector — 38-pin finger header
- Mixed-signal connector — 40-pin mixed-signal header
- RVI Header — RealView® interface header for Cortex-M1 debugging
- User Interaction
- OLED Display — Organic LED display, 96x16 pixels
- LEDs — 12-red
- Switches — 8 DIP switches, 7 push switches, 4 in navigation layout
- Push-button Reset — system reset with Schmitt-trigger device
- Potentiometer — connected to analog pin of Fusion FPGA
- Fusion Device Support
- PWM Circuit — pulse width modulation circuit
- Current Sensor — 2 circuits for 1.5 V and 3.3 V current monitoring
- Temperature Monitor Diode — external temperature diode connected to Fusion FPGA
- Gate Drive — 2 external p-channel MOSFET
Mixed-signal Power Manager Demonstration
The Mixed-signal Power Manager Demonstration includes a reference design targeted to the Fusion Advanced Development Kit that delivers superior power monitoring, power sequencing, and threshold control of up to 16 power regulators. Users can configure power management sequencing, levels, or thresholds using an easy-to-use standalone graphical user interface (GUI) tool, which also enables the user to program the MPM design into the Fusion device. Designers using MPM will be able to replace discrete power management devices, add more flexibility by leveraging Fusion's reprogrammable flash FPGA technology, and reduce total parts count at the board level. MPM will deliver highly-configurable, integrated power management using one high-reliability low-power flash-based Fusion mixed-signal FPGA. The MPM user's guide and zip file are listed below.
